Output 033343259ac73672b2febf7d260bf2d2717c0f7e88943f055b0e97409ccc9cea:2

value
3406807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db15ace0a905953a4415cd8a0e1acb5da8024891 OP_EQUAL
address
3MfRsaez5qPBJt5sAaaKiv3c1mhmVdT43p
transaction
033343259ac73672b2febf7d260bf2d2717c0f7e88943f055b0e97409ccc9cea
spent
true